I heard somewhere that LA locals are viewable nationwide....is this true or are they spot beamed just to So Cal??

All DISH WA markets are spot beamed.

I recall that only those few markets on 77W aren't spot beamed. I'd hate to think that DISH was burning CONUS bandwidth on LIL channels.

To more directly answer the question, the four major networks from LA (HD and SD) plus Ion West (SD-feed only) are CONUS on Directv. Dish has KTLA (SD-feed only) on CONUS. I hope that helps.
